This protects your account in two ways: You’ll prevent unwanted items from being scanned to your account, and you’ll also prevent unauthorized access to your Google Drive documents.Without a PIN, anyone with access to your printer could browse and print files from Google Drive. Once configured, you’ll need to enter the PIN every time you use the Google Drive app to scan. Protect your account with a PIN–especially in an office setting. This establishes that you have control of both the Google account and scanner/printer. You’ll also need access to both a web browser and the Google account where you want to store scanned items. For example, I’ve configured both Brother and HP printers to scan directly to Google Drive. To enable the ability to scan directly to Google Drive you’ll need a network-connected scanner–or a multi-function printer/scanner–that supports a Google Drive connection. Unlike locally-stored files, documents on Google Drive are simple to share, accessible from anywhere, and easy to find with Cloud Search, which delivers keyword search (like Google search, but for your organization’s G Suite data).
